Study Finds EU Digital Regulations Cost U.S. Companies Up to $97.6 Billion Annually (10)
WASHINGTON, July 29 (TNSrpt) -- The Computer and Communications Industry Association issued the following news release on July 28, 2025: * * * New Study Finds EU Digital Regulations Cost U.S. Companies up to $97.6 Billion Annually A new economic study from the CCIA Research Center reveals that European Union (EU) regulations on digital services are imposing enormous costs on American companies--up to $97.6 billion annually, with a conservative estimate of $38.9 billion.
